Is trading and selling herring permissible or forbidden, knowing that those who buy it are Muslims?
It is forbidden to sell herring to those who celebrate Sham el-Nessim; this holiday is prohibited, and selling it is considered assisting in sin, whether the celebrant is Muslim or non-Muslim. Some scholars have deemed it subtly disliked (makrooh tanzeeh) to sell items that aid in the celebrations of disbelievers.
